Sorry for the late reply, I don't know why Gmail filtered this out to spam. > > shrink_slab_memcg() races with mem_cgroup_css_online(). A visibility of CSS_ONLINE flag > in shrink_slab_memcg()->mem_cgroup_online() does not guarantee that you will see > memcg->nodeinfo[nid]->shrinker_deferred != NULL in count_nr_deferred(). This may occur > because of processor reordering on !x86 (there is no a common lock or memory barriers). > > Regarding to shrinker_map this is not a problem due to map check in shrink_slab_memcg(). > The map can't be NULL there. > > Regarding to shrinker_deferred you should prove either this is not a problem too, > or to add proper synchronization (maybe, based on barriers) or to add some similar check > (maybe, in shrink_slab_memcg() too). It seems shrink_slab_memcg() might see shrinker_deferred as NULL either due to the same reason. I don't think there is a guarantee it won't happen. We just need guarantee CSS_ONLINE is seen after shrinker_maps and shrinker_deferred are allocated, so I'm supposed barriers before "css->flags |= CSS_ONLINE" should work. So the below patch may be ok: diff --git a/mm/memcontrol.c b/mm/memcontrol.c index df128cab900f..9f7fb0450d69 100644 --- a/mm/memcontrol.c +++ b/mm/memcontrol.c @@ -5539,6 +5539,12 @@ static int mem_cgroup_css_online(struct cgroup_subsys_state *css) return -ENOMEM; } + /* + * Barrier for CSS_ONLINE, so that shrink_slab_memcg() sees shirnker_maps + * and shrinker_deferred before CSS_ONLINE. + */ + smp_mb(); + /* Online state pins memcg ID, memcg ID pins CSS */ refcount_set(&memcg->id.ref, 1); css_get(css); Or add one more check for shrinker_deferred sounds acceptable as well. > Kirill >
